Output f73689596cfbfec14e8af65a552ffe7a5a657f65df17c00e181cf636c7fba55d:0

value
18000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c0417b27924e06f95ab42a67e736dcd2877086 OP_EQUAL
address
31wZb6P2ZGoQusxnRNhxg1MU9cJbSns5t1
transaction
f73689596cfbfec14e8af65a552ffe7a5a657f65df17c00e181cf636c7fba55d
confirmations
238256
spent
true